Abstract:According to the feeding performance requirement of the machine spindle,the main dimensional parameters of the tubular permanent magnet linear motor were calculated firstly,and then through finite element analysis(FEA),output performances of the motor were optimized.Finally the control scheme based on independent phase current control loop was proposed,so that the whole design of linear motor feeding system of the machine tool was accomplished.The designed large thrust tubular permanent magnet linear motor can achieve linear feeding drive of the machine spindle,which exhibits excellent characteristics of high efficient,high precision and fast dynamic response,and so on.
